Ingredients

For the Red Velvet Brownie Base:

  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on red food coloring
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

For the Cheesecake Swirl:

  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 egg

Ingredient Highlights

  • Red Food Coloring: I use this to achieve the vibrant red color that makes the brownies so visually striking.
  • Cream Cheese: The cheesecake swirl adds a creamy, tangy layer that balances the sweetness of the brownie.
  • Butter: I melt the butter for a rich, smooth texture in the brownie base.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Prepare the Brownie Base

  1. I pre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ease an 8×8-in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per.
  2. I melt the butter in a microwave-safe bowl and stir in the sugar, eggs, vanilla extract, and red food coloring until smooth.
  3. I sift together the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t, then fold them into the wet mixture until just combined.

Make the Cheesecake Swirl

  1. In a separate bowl, I beat the cream cheese, sugar, vanilla extract, and egg until smooth and creamy.

Layer the Brownies

  1. I pour the red velvet brownie batter into the prepared baking pan and smooth it into an even layer.
  2. I dollop spoonfuls of the cheesecake mixture on top of the brownie batter and use a knife or toothpick to swirl the two together for a marbled effect.

Bake the Brownies

  1. I bake the brownies for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with just a few moist crumbs.

Cool and Serve

  1. I let the brownies cool completely in the pan before cutting them into squares and serving.

Freezing and Storage

  • Storing: I store these br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days, making them perfect for quick snacking throughout the week. If I want them to last a bit longer, I can refrigerate them for up to 1 week. When refrigerated, the brownies maintain their rich flavor and moist texture, though they may firm up a bit. To enjoy them at their best, I can warm them up in the microwave for a few seconds to soften them slightly, making them even more indulgent. To keep them fresh for longer, I make sure the container is tightly sealed to prevent them from drying out.
  • Freezing: I freeze the brownies for up to 2 months to preserve their freshness. To ensure they stay in perfect condition, I wrap each brownie individually in plastic wrap to protect it from freezer burn. Then, I place the wrapped brownies in a freezer-safe container or resealable freezer bag. When I’m ready to enjoy them, I simply thaw the brownies at room temperature for a few hours, or for a quicker option, I can heat them in the microwave for 20-30 seconds. FAQ Section

Q: Can I use gel food coloring instead of liquid food coloring?
A: Yes, I can use gel food coloring for a more vibrant color, but I may need to adjust the amount slightly.

Q: How do I know when the brownies are done baking?
A: I check with a toothpick inserted into the center. If it comes out with a few moist crumbs, they’re done.

Q: Can I make these brownies ahead of time?
A: Absolutely! I can make them a day ahead and store them in an airtight container until ready to serve.
